Is 150g equal to 1 cup?

The answer to whether 150g is equal to 1 cup depends on what you are measuring. Cups are a common unit of volume measurement used in cooking, while grams are a unit of weight measurement used to measure the mass of an object.

In general, the conversion of grams to cups will depend on the density of the substance being measured. Different substances have different densities, meaning that a given volume of one substance may weigh more or less than the same volume of another substance.

For example, 1 cup of flour may weigh less than 1 cup of sugar, even though they occupy the same volume, because flour is less dense than sugar. This means that when converting grams to cups, it is important to consider the specific substance being measured.

To convert grams to cups, it is necessary to know the density of the substance being measured. The density of a substance is typically measured in grams per milliliter (g/mL) or grams per cubic centimeter (g/cm3). Once the density is known, it is possible to use a conversion factor to convert grams to cups.

It is important to note that this conversion is only an approximation and may not be completely accurate due to variations in density and other factors. Additionally, the exact measurement of a cup may vary depending on the country or region where it is being used.

In the United States, a cup typically refers to a volume measurement of 240 milliliters. However, in other countries such as Australia, a cup is typically defined as 250 milliliters. This means that the conversion of grams to cups may vary depending on the location where the measurement is being made.
